Incisional hernia: Abdominal surgery causes a flaw in the abdominal wall. This flaw can create an area of weakness through which a hernia may develop. This occurs after 2%-10% of all abdominal surgeries, although some people are more at risk. Even after surgical repair, incisional hernias may return.

WitrynaChronic groin pain is defined as pain that is present for more than 3 months after the inguinal hernia surgery. Chronic groin pain can occur in more than 15% of patients who have this surgery. WitrynaMost patients can take Acetaminophen (Tylenol) instead of the prescription medicine for pain after hernia surgery. Ibuprofen (Advil) or Naproxen (Aleve) can often be taken in addition to the Tylenol. WitrynaSymptoms of hernias may include a visible bulge or lump, discomfort or pain, and a feeling of heaviness in the affected area. In some cases, hernias may be asymptomatic and only detected during a routine physical exam. Treatment for hernias typically involves surgery, although in some cases, a watchful waiting approach may be taken.
